A Deep Dive Into “placeholder”
Meaning
- [Noun]
- Something used or included temporarily or as a substitute for something that is not known or must remain generic; that which holds, denotes or reserves a place for something to come later.
- (graphical user interface) A non-editable caption initially displayed in a blank text box to indicate its function.
